2022 BMW 2 Series M240i xDrive
30,715 miles | 20.72 miles away
$44,891
30,715 miles | 20.72 miles away
$44,891
19,827 miles | 11.88 miles away
$45,364
was $47,156
15,768 miles | 4.34 miles away
$48,495
33,122 miles | 8.22 miles away
$42,799
53,521 miles | 11.88 miles away
1-5 of 5 Vehicles